Free use under Pixabay matters, but so does comprehending the license correctly

 

 


One of the most crucial practical information for anybody discovering Chill Your Music is that tracks on Pixabay are openly significant as totally free for usage under the Pixabay Content License. Pixabay's own license summary says users may utilize material free of charge, do not need Click here to associate the author, and may modify or adjust the content into new works. At the same time, Pixabay likewise lists clear limitations, consisting of that users can not merely redistribute the material on a standalone basis and can not utilize trademarked material in prohibited industrial methods. That means the music can be highly beneficial, but the license still is worthy of to be checked out and respected.

 

 


That point is worth making since individuals typically search for terms like chill your music free music, chill your music stock music, and even chill your music creative commons. The precise public framing here is Pixabay license usage, not a generic presumption that every "free" track works without conditions. Still, for developers, the takeaway is really favorable: Chill Your Music is publicly available in a manner that makes it really available for video, social, discussion, and material workflows, especially for people who need usable royalty complimentary music without a complex barrier to entry.
